Jerk chicken is sold pretty much anywhere. While jerk chicken is the most popular choice, you’ll find the jerk spices used with other types of meat. Scotch bonnet chili (watch out – sometimes it can get spicy!).Jerk is the combination of spices used as a rub to marinate the meat before grilling over hot coals to give that smoky finish. Where to find: Everywhere!
